Skinner’s Brewery
Skinner's is a British brewery founded in 1997 by Steve Skinner in Truro, Cornwall, England. The company produces cask ales and bottled beers, the names of which often come from Cornish folklore.- Email: info@skinnersbrewery.com

Truro Cathedral
Church
Photo: tracey maclean, CC BY-SA 2.0.
The Cathedral of the Blessed Virgin Mary is a Church of England cathedral in the city of Truro, Cornwall. It was built between 1880 and 1910 to a Gothic Revival design by John Loughborough Pearson on the site of the parish church of St Mary. Hall for Cornwall
Theater building
Photo: Mr Eugene Birchall, CC BY-SA 2.0.
The Hall for Cornwall, known as Truro City Hall until 1997, is an events venue in Boscawen Street in Truro, Cornwall. The building, which was previously the headquarters of Truro City Council, is a Grade II* listed building. Hall for Cornwall is situated 2,100 feet northwest of Skinner’s Brewery.

Calenick
Hamlet
Photo: Tony Atkin,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Calenick is a hamlet in the civil parish of Kea, about a mile south of Truro in Cornwall, England, UK. It is at the head of Calenick Creek, which opens into the River Truro near Sunny Corner.
Malpas
Village
Photo: David Stowell,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Malpas is a riverside village, and former port, in the civil parish of St Clement, in Cornwall, England, United Kingdom. It is situated two miles southeast of the city of Truro, on the confluence of the Truro River and the Tresillian River.
St Clement
Village
Photo: N p holmes, CC BY-SA 3.0.
St Clement is a civil parish and village in Cornwall, England, United Kingdom. It is situated southeast of Truro in the valley of the Tresillian River.
